]> git.neil.brown.name Git - history.git/commit
[NET]: free_netdev - fix leaky drivers
authorStephen Hemminger <shemminger@osdl.org>
Tue, 19 Aug 2003 14:00:39 +0000 (07:00 -0700)
committerStephen Hemminger <shemminger@osdl.org>
Tue, 19 Aug 2003 14:00:39 +0000 (07:00 -0700)
commit953fc0bd9fbdeb365788430c4e22dbf082ba2a71
treede975df386d84c68a09baf25b3ed85d1df7c6eaa
parentde752cfc5016b70ca5c8c3c9ef67eba90da9ed6a
[NET]: free_netdev - fix leaky drivers

When doing the audit for this change, it was obvious that several drivers
allocate but never free the net_device.

This fixes these drivers.  This patch is riskier than the earlier
ones, because it isn't just a simple substitution and maybe there
is a reason they never free.
drivers/message/fusion/mptlan.c
drivers/net/lasi_82596.c
drivers/net/wan/cosa.c
drivers/usb/gadget/ether.c